At least four people die in shooting in Louisville, Kentucky – News

  • A gun attack broke out in Louisville, Kentucky.
  • At least four people were killed and at least eight others were injured, police said.

The gun attack happened at a bank building in downtown Louisville. The suspected shooter was also dead, police said. Two police officers were among the injured, one of the officers is in critical condition.

Louisville Deputy Police Chief Paul Humphrey told reporters that officers “encountered an active gunman” at the scene. At that time, shots were still being fired inside the building. The two officers were injured in the exchange of fire with him. It is still unclear whether the shooter was killed by police or shot himself.

Witnesses leaving the building told WHAS-TV that they heard gunshots inside the building. Numerous police vehicles could be seen on television pictures. The FBI said its agents also responded to the shooting.

According to previous investigations, the man had a connection to the bank and was either a current or former employee. Further background of the act were initially unclear.

Kentucky Governor Andy Beshear said two of the dead were close friends of his. Another person he is friends with is currently being treated in the hospital. “It’s terrible,” said the Democrat, fighting back tears.
